Financial Stress Management

The majority of marriages show that monetary problem is the leading cause of stress in a marriage. So, you should deal with them. In such case, you can obtain the advantageous reference by using a lot of books and through both television programs and web sites.

As the basic premise, make a table all your debts and the interest rate you are indebted on each of them. Start with paying the debts off by making more than minimum monthly payment. It should be started from the highest interest account. And then, you must investigate about how you can shift the high interest debt into lower interest debt.

Stress management for financial matter will be little bit difficult. So, do you have any thought to obtain additional money to pay off your debts? Yes, you are correct. You have to make a record of your each expense as a starting point. After a week, you will recognize how you are using your discretionary earning. It will be a suffering at first of overlooking some of those discretionary items. But, the capacity for paying off high interest debt is worth it.

Some tips for alleviating Stress And Anxiety that you may use when you come in contact with a situation that you know will cause Stress And Anxiety is to try some self calming techniques. Deep breathing is a common and effective coping skill. Take several deep breathes and make sure to breathe in through your nose and out through your mouth.
This will help you take a break from the situation give you time to think and also calm your physical reaction to the stressor. Imagery is also another great tool that can help prevent Stress And Anxiety; Close your eyes and picture yourself handling the situation well without fear or anxiety. Another example of imagery would be to imagine you are in a different place which is peaceful and do this until you are able to regain control.

Get The Latest Medications For Irritable Bowel Syndrome To Help With Your Disorder

IBS has become a common health disorder in today’s word. In fact, it affects up to 30% of people at some time in their lives. There are many symptoms of the disorder which include diarrhoea, a bloated stomach, abdominal pain, slow digestion, constipation, sickness, backaches, flatulence, dizziness, and a noisy tummy.

A person who suffers from IBS can suffer problems mentally as well as physically. A common feeling with IBS is the feeling of having to empty your bowels, but in reality you can’t. For those suffering from IBS this can become extremely frustrating.

If you have suffered from any of the previously mentioned symptoms, you need to consult your Doctor and undergo an assessment.

The assessment will mean you can be properly diagnosed by your Doctor as to whether you have Irritable Bowel Syndrome or not. If you do have IBS your Doctor will be able to let you know how severe your condition is.

Those who severely suffer from irritable bowel syndrome generally aren’t able to do work or other daily tasks regularly. This is when irritable bowel syndrome medications become really important. Considering all the types of irritable bowel syndrome medications is very important. You need to pick the right medication to help control your condition.

IBS Medications

One of the most commonly prescribed irritable bowel syndrome medications is Alostron. Alostron assists those with irritable bowel syndrome by helping to reduce their abdominal sensitivity. It gives more relief of the day to day symptoms, especially for women who are pregnant and who can suffer bouts of more severe symptoms due to their pregnancy. Tegaserod is another popular irritable bowel syndrome medication. It works by speeding up the movement of the intestines, therefore it is a little different to Alostron.

The overall goal of irritable bowel syndrome medications is to relieve symptoms to the point that they aren’t interfering in everyday life and everyday activities that people must do. Medications are generally prescribed when all other types of relief have been tried.

But, you should not take these drugs without supervision. Work with your Doctor in order to decide which method of treatment is best for you and the particular condition you are suffering from. Along with your doctor, you will probably work with a nutritionist to create a diet and exercise regime that might be helpful in relieving symptoms. The food you eat can play a huge part in how severe your irritable bowel syndrome is. With this disorder, you want to eat right and find ways to maintain a healthy lifestyle. It will make irritable bowel syndrome much easier to deal with.

The Relationship Between Stress And Irritable Bowel Syndrome

If you suffer with IBS bowel syndrome then you know the importance of getting treatment. One of the first things that you and your doctor will talk about in regards to your IBS is that of stress. Stress is a factor that can do damage to many aspects of your health including irritable bowel syndrome.

First and foremost, don’t make the mistake of thinking that stress in and of itself can cause IBS. This is not the case. Stress is generally brought into our lives by a troubled lifestyle. The more stresses that you put onto your body, the less healthy and capable of producing a healthy reaction it is.

Remember that we don’t know what actually causes IBS. In effect, all we can do is to treat the symptoms that can come from it. But, we do know what makes it worse and stress is one of those factors. Stress can also worsen other conditions like sciatic nerve pain and migraine headache discomfort.

Why Stress Hurts

The facts on why stress hurts your IBS are clear. For a healthy person in an ideal situation, stress is controlled by the body. Your body has a pain inhibition system that turns on when it is struggling with pain to help you to cope with it.

But, what has been found in patients with IBS is that this hypersensitivity doesn’t go away. Your body doesn’t turn on the right pain inhibition system and you feel the muscles of your gut hurting.

For example, it has been a long and stressful day, you are looking forward to a good meal and sleep. If you are experiencing prolonged or repeated episodes of stress, you’ll find it not so easy to relax. Instead, you go home and eat a meal. No matter if you eat during your stressful event or after, your will have that awful ache in your abdomen that comes with IBS.

This would be a normal feeling of being full for some, but for those with IBS it hurts. Your body doesn’t turn off the pain function that a healthy body would which in turn allows you to feel more of the pain associated with eating during or after stress.
